For optimum performance and safety in your warehouse, industrial machinery needs to be maintained regularly. When carrying out maintenance, remember these five tips to ensure your check is as efficient as possible:&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Record Machinery Use&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
A detailed log of how and when your machinery is used can help to keep it in a good working order. This record helps to track how much the machinery is being used, or in some cases even when it has been misused by an operator and perhaps even damaged. Extensive training can stop this misuse from happening. After all, poor operator use can lead to accidents and faster deterioration of the machinery.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Keep all of your records updated and in order - messy records are next to useless. Good records can help you to identify issues early, whilst also carrying out the maintenance your machinery needs at the right times.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Check Parts and Accessories&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
This may seem obvious, but it is an often overlooked factor when it comes to maintaining your industrial machinery. A high attention to detail is needed in order for this to be effective. Your planned maintenance should be able to determine when a part needs replacing, or if it is showing signs of over wearing.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Keep track of the age of your parts during maintenance also. This can have a big impact on both replacement timelines and the overall health of your machinery.&lt;br /&gt;

Cleaning&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Whether we like it or not, cleaning has a big impact on the maintenance of your machinery. Productivity, quality of machinery and of your work can all increase as the result of a regularly cleaned machine. Not only that, but it prolongs the overall life of your machine.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Seals and filler can help to prevent contamination, whilst lubrication can stop water from contaminating the machine with rust over long periods of time.&lt;br /&gt;
